MEDIUM type confusiondjango
Type Confusion in Django
Django-Specific Remediation
Remediating type confusion in Django requires a defense-in-depth approach that leverages Django's built-in validation mechanisms while adding application-specific type safety.
Model Field Validation: Always use Django's field validation and consider adding custom validators for critical fields:
Related CWEs: inputValidation
CWE ID Name Severity CWE-20 Improper Input Validation HIGH CWE-22 Path Traversal HIGH CWE-74 Injection CRITICAL CWE-77 Command Injection CRITICAL CWE-78 OS Command Injection CRITICAL CWE-79 Cross-site Scripting (XSS) HIGH CWE-89 SQL Injection CRITICAL CWE-90 LDAP Injection HIGH CWE-91 XML Injection HIGH CWE-94 Code Injection CRITICAL